Skip to content

Conversation

@seffradev
Copy link
Contributor

What does this PR do?

This simplifies and sets up the project to abide to practices presented in the book Modern CMake for C++ by Rafał Świdziński.

Why is it important?

It makes dependent targets simpler to write, and fixes (parts of) #50.

Related issues

@seffradev seffradev force-pushed the build-system branch 2 times, most recently from 2245b5b to 892c8f5 Compare August 9, 2025 22:39
@oleg-nenashev oleg-nenashev added the chore Maintenance label Oct 20, 2025
@oleg-nenashev oleg-nenashev changed the title Streamline the project build Streamline the project build and align with the best practices Oct 20, 2025
@oleg-nenashev oleg-nenashev marked this pull request as ready for review October 20, 2025 19:48
@oleg-nenashev oleg-nenashev self-requested a review as a code owner October 20, 2025 19:48
@oleg-nenashev
Copy link
Collaborator

The build is passing in the current environments

@oleg-nenashev oleg-nenashev merged commit d6ec912 into testcontainers:main Oct 20, 2025
3 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

chore Maintenance

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ants